You’re a Money Boss
Your careful planning and disciplined approach make you adept at managing your money. You’re the budgeting ninja who knows exactly where every penny goes. You’ve got your emergency fund padded and your financial goals mapped out to the last detail.
Key Strengths:
- You’re a master planner, meticulously tracking your expenses and sticking to your budget.
- You’re always prepared for the unexpected, with a well-padded emergency fund to fall back on.
- You make wise decisions by thoroughly researching and analyzing your options before taking action.
Areas for Improvement:
- Sometimes your meticulous planning can make you inflexible when faced with unexpected changes.
- You may prioritize financial goals over enjoying life’s experiences, leading to burnout.
- Your focus on details and long-term planning may cause you to overlook opportunities for spontaneous enjoyment or investment.
Here are some specific considerations for the Money Boss:
- Keep up the good work with budgeting and saving, but don’t forget to leave room for spontaneity and enjoyment in your financial plan.
- Consider seeking opportunities for growth and investment that align with your long-term goals, while still being mindful of risk management.
- Remember to prioritize self-care and balance in your life, ensuring that your financial success doesn’t come at the expense of your overall well-being.
Key Action:
Schedule a monthly review of your budget and financial goals (include any significant others) to ensure you’re staying on track and making progress. This will help you maintain your meticulous planning while also allowing for adjustments as needed each month. Consider using a tool such as Monarch Money.
